The story
Within the elegant neoclassical walls of Hotel Royal in Geneva, L'Aparté stands as one of the city’s most accomplished dining destinations. The restaurant is described by the hotel as one of “Geneva’s best kept culinary secrets,” a quiet confidence that has been validated by a Michelin star for high-quality cooking.
The setting is intimate, part of a 4-star superior hotel where marble and gilt create a refined atmosphere. L'Aparté is a place for focused, unhurried meals—the kind of evening where the kitchen’s precision speaks for itself. The cuisine is Modern French, rooted in technique and clarity, with an International sensibility that reflects Geneva’s cosmopolitan character.
Beyond the dining room, the restaurant extends its reach to a riverside terrace for warmer months, and offers a Chef’s Table for those who want a closer view of the craft. Private dining and event spaces are also available, making it a versatile choice for both quiet dinners and celebratory gatherings.
L'Aparté is part of the Manotel group, which also runs Le Bistro and Bogie’s Bar within the same hotel—but this Michelin-starred address is the one that draws serious diners. Whether you are a guest at the hotel or visiting from across the city, the restaurant delivers a consistently polished experience that justifies its reputation.
